Maine guide to Health InsuranceHow healthy is living
in Maine?

For the second straight year, Maine is ranked as the 8th healthiest state to live in, according to the 2011 edition of America's Health Rankings® by the United Health Foundation

Maine's best and worst category rankings:

  • Violent Crime – 1st
  • Lack of Health Insurance – 6th
  • Early Prenatal Care – 6th
  • Geographic Disparity – 6th
  • Immunization Coverage – 36th
  • Cancer Deaths – 38th

Does Maine have a health insurance high risk pool?

health-insurance risk poolsIMPORTANT UPDATE: Starting in 2010, Maine started offering health care insurance coverage to residents through the federally established temporary high-risk pool program. To find out more about Maine's participation, click here.

Risk pools are state-sponsored programs to help people with a history of medical problems in their family to purchase coverage. These pools are for people who can afford to buy health insurance, but are not able to get underwritten in the private market because of a pre-existing health condition. These programs can vary significantly from state to state in price, benefits and number of people served. Often insurance companies doing business in the state are required to contribute to the pool to keep it in the black. In the best cases, they allow people to be able to switch jobs or become self-employed without the fear of losing their health insurance coverage. Read more about risk pools here.

Maine DHA —  The Maine Legislature created DHA in 2003 as “an independent executive agency to arrange for the provision of comprehensive, affordable health care coverage to eligible small employers, including the self-employed, their employees and dependents, and individuals on a voluntary basis.

Maine’s Consumer Guide to Individual Health Insurance —  Guaranteed-issue individual health insurance is available in Maine from Anthem Blue Cross and Blue Shield, MEGA Life & Health Insurance Company, and several health maintenance organizations (HMOs). This guide attempts to help you compare and contrast the options.

Maine Senate delays action on health insurance exchange

Bangor Daily News–Maine’s Republican legislature has prevented the creation of a health insurance exchange until after the U.S. Supreme Court releases its decision regarding the Affordable Care Act. The legislation also says that only licensed insurance brokers can enroll people in health plans through an exchange, and navigators must also be fingerprinted.

Maine Republicans slow installation of health care law as court ruling looms

Maine Sun Journal–Some of Maine’s legislators have slowed the process to create a state health insurance exchange, wanting to wait to hear the U.S. Supreme Court’s decision on the Affordable Care Act.
